Could the Warriors Trade for Giannis?
The Golden State Warriors are facing a massive decision about their future. Right now, they have a 27–22 record and sit 8th in the Western Conference. That puts them in the playoff mix, but not in the group of teams that truly look like title favorites. Is it time for them to make a move?
Giannis Is Looking for a New Team
Giannis Antetokounmpo plays for the Milwaukee Bucks, where he won a championship and became one of the faces of the NBA. But recently NBA insider Shams Charania reported that Giannias wants to be traded.
That alone is huge news. Superstars like Giannis almost never become available, especially players who are still in their prime. Giannis is averaging 28 points and 10 rebounds per game, and he impacts the game on offense and defense every night. He’s strong, fast, and one of the best two-way players in the league.
Why the Warriors Are Paying Attention
For Golden State, the timing matters. Stephen Curry is still playing at an elite level, averaging 27 points per game and hitting almost five three-pointers a night. Even at this stage of his career, Curry is still good enough to lead a championship team.
The Warriors know they can’t waste these seasons. Waiting for young players to slowly develop may not line up with Curry’s timeline anymore. The pressure to “do right by Steph” is real.
Why a Big Move Feels Necessary
That pressure increased after Jimmy Butler tore his ACL. Butler was supposed to be the second superstar who could help Curry in tough playoff moments. Without him, the Warriors don’t have a clear partner who can take over games when defenses focus on Curry.
What a Trade Would Cost
To get Giannis, the Warriors would likely need to send out Jimmy Butler to make the salaries work, along with young forward Jonathan Kuminga and four unprotected first-round draft picks. It would be one of the biggest trades in franchise history.
Is It Worth It?
If Curry and Giannis played together, the Warriors would instantly be back in championship contention. Giannis would control the paint and anchor the defense, while Curry stretches the floor in ways no one else can.
The cost would be enormous, but championship windows close fast. For Golden State, trading for Giannis might be the risky move that gives them one more real shot at another title.
